ChatGPT in Browse/Search mode pulls from Bing's index. In knowledge-answer mode, it draws from training data weighted toward authoritative, encyclopedic sources. Citation factors: Bing domain authority, neutral tone (no superlatives), FAQPage schema, presence on G2/Trustpilot/Wikipedia, and IndexNow for Bing rapid indexing.
Gemini is unique: it pulls exclusively from Google's own index. There is no shortcut: strong traditional SEO is the mandatory entry ticket. Because Google's AI features are rooted in its core ranking systems, the signals that matter are Google's own: featured snippet eligibility, E-E-A-T signals, page experience (LCP under 2.5s, INP under 200ms), section-level extractability, and Knowledge Graph entity presence. Gemini prioritizes pages that already rank in positions 1–5 on Google.
Perplexity actively crawls with PerplexityBot and weights freshness heavily: content updated within the last 30 days receives significantly higher citation probability. BLUF (Bottom Line Up Front) structure is critical: the direct answer must appear in the first 1–2 sentences of each section. Comparison and "best of" content achieves 32.5% higher citation rates on Perplexity.
Grok by xAI is unique in incorporating real-time X (Twitter) data alongside Bing's index. Social proof from X: brand mentions, engagement, and authority signals: influences citation. Grok weights recency more heavily than other LLMs. IndexNow protocol for Bing ensures rapid indexing of updated pages.
Claude uses the Brave Search index as its primary web source, plus curated training data from vetted publications. Publication authority and clear author attribution with Person schema are the key citation factors. llms.txt is implemented as a supplementary file for AI agents that read it.

LLM SEO (Large Language Model SEO) is the technical practice of optimizing a website's content, structure, and authority signals so that large language models: including ChatGPT, Google Gemini, Perplexity, Grok, and Claude: select your brand as a citation when generating answers to user queries. It goes deeper than general GEO by implementing platform-specific signals for each LLM's distinct crawling, indexing, and ranking behavior.
ChatGPT in Browse/Search mode pulls from Bing's index. Citation factors include: domain authority recognized by Bing, encyclopedic and neutral tone, presence on authoritative third-party platforms (G2, Trustpilot, Wikipedia), FAQPage schema, and IndexNow integration for Bing rapid indexing.
Google Gemini pulls exclusively from Google's own index: traditional SEO is the mandatory entry ticket. Google's guidance confirms AI features are rooted in its core ranking systems, so the signals that matter are Google's own: featured snippet eligibility, E-E-A-T signals, page experience, section-level extractability, and Knowledge Graph entity presence.
Perplexity uses its own PerplexityBot crawler plus Bing. Citation factors include: allowing PerplexityBot in robots.txt, content freshness (updates within 30 days), BLUF structure, and comparison-style content which generates 32.5% higher citation rates. Perplexity refreshes high-citation pages every 24–72 hours.
llms.txt is a root-level plain text file that lists your site's most authoritative pages in markdown format designed for AI agents to read and index. It is an emerging convention with uneven adoption: Google has publicly confirmed its systems do not use llms.txt, and no major AI platform has officially documented it as a ranking input. It is implemented as a low-cost hedge for AI agents that read it, never as a substitute for the signals that actually drive citations.
Grok uses Bing's index plus real-time X (Twitter) data. Citation factors include: allowing xAI-Grok crawler in robots.txt, IndexNow protocol for Bing rapid submission, active X/Twitter presence, and recency: Grok weights recent content more heavily than other LLMs.
Claude uses the Brave Search index as its primary web source, plus training data from vetted publications. Citation factors include: allowing ClaudeBot in robots.txt, Brave Search indexing, publication authority, and clear author attribution with Person schema markup. llms.txt is implemented as a low-cost extra, though no platform has confirmed using it as a ranking input.
LLM citation tracking uses Share of Model (SoM) measurement: running target queries across all five platforms monthly and recording citation frequency. Supporting data comes from GA4 AI referral traffic (chatgpt.com, ai.google.com, perplexity.ai, x.com) and Looker Studio dashboards for trend visualization.
